25 Fun Valentine's Day Party Game Ideas for Everyone

Valentine 's Day is the perfect occasion to gather friends, family, or that special someone for a celebration filled with laughter and a party involves more than just decorations and delicious treats; it requires engaging activities that bring everyone you are hosting a cozy Galentine' s brunch, a classroom party for kids, or a romantic evening for couples, having a variety of games ensures that your guests remain entertained throughout the classic board games with a romantic twist to high-energy physical challenges, the right selection of activities can transform a simple gathering into an unforgettable experience that captures the essence of love and friendship.

1. Valentine Conversation Heart Bingo

Valentine Conversation Heart Bingo - 25 Valentine's Day Party Game Ideas

Searching for a classic game that appeals to all ages? Valentine Conversation Heart Bingo is a fantastic choice for any festive of traditional numbers, players use the sweet and colorful conversation hearts as markers on their bingo cards are typically decorated with romantic symbols like Cupid, roses, and various phrases found on the game is incredibly easy to set up and provides a relaxed environment where guests can chat while they wait for the next icon to be works perfectly for school parties or a casual afternoon with friends, making it a staple for holiday entertainment.

2. Candy Heart Stacking Challenge

Candy Heart Stacking Challenge - 25 Valentine's Day Party Game Ideas

How high can you stack those tiny, chalky candies before they come tumbling down? The Candy Heart Stacking Challenge is a fast-paced, "minute to win it" style activity that brings out the competitive spirit in are given a pile of conversation hearts and a set amount of time, usually sixty seconds, to build the tallest tower sounds simple, but the irregular shapes of the candies make it surprisingly game is great for groups because it requires minimal supplies and generates a lot of excitement and laughter as towers inevitably collapse at the last second.

3. Valentine Scavenger Hunt

Valentine Scavenger Hunt - 25 Valentine's Day Party Game Ideas

Are you ready to send your guests on an exciting adventure around your home or party venue? A Valentine Scavenger Hunt is an interactive way to keep people moving and can create a series of rhyming clues that lead participants to various hidden treasures or themed a more modern twist, ask guests to take photos of specific things, such as something red, a heart-shaped object, or two people shaking game is highly customizable, allowing you to tailor the difficulty level to the age of your guests, ensuring everyone has a wonderful time searching for hidden surprises.

4. Romantic Movie Trivia

Romantic Movie Trivia - 25 Valentine's Day Party Game Ideas

Test your guests' knowledge of silver screen romance with a dedicated Romantic Movie Trivia game is ideal for film buffs and couples who enjoy cozying up for a movie can prepare questions ranging from classic Hollywood romances to modern romantic comedies, covering famous quotes, iconic scenes, and celebrity make it more interactive, play short clips or soundtracks and have guests guess the film serves as a great icebreaker, sparking conversations about favorite movies and memorable cinematic can be awarded small themed prizes like popcorn buckets or cinema gift cards to enhance the fun.

5. Valentine Pictionary

Valentine Pictionary - 25 Valentine's Day Party Game Ideas

Unleash your inner artist with a lively round of Valentine Pictionary, a game that never fails to provide take turns drawing romantic concepts, holiday symbols, or famous love stories on a large pad or whiteboard while their teammates try to guess the prompts might include a box of chocolates, a bouquet of roses, or even specific romantic gestures like a pressure of the ticking clock often leads to hilarious and abstract drawings that keep the energy is a wonderful way to foster teamwork and creativity, making it a highlight of any Valentine's Day celebration or social gathering.

6. Heart Shaped Ring Toss

Heart Shaped Ring Toss - 25 Valentine's Day Party Game Ideas

Transform a traditional carnival game into a holiday favorite with a Heart Shaped Ring activity is perfect for outdoor parties or large indoor spaces where guests can move around can use decorated bottles or upright stakes as targets, and provide players with heart-shaped rings made from plastic or even stiffened goal is to land as many rings as possible on the targets from a designated is a visually appealing game that adds a touch of whimsy to your decor while providing a simple yet addictive challenge for guests of all ages to enjoy during the festivities.

7. Valentine Charades

Valentine Charades - 25 Valentine's Day Party Game Ideas

Can you act out "falling in love" or "a secret admirer" without saying a single word? Valentine Charades is a classic party game that relies on physical comedy and quick your guests into two teams and have them take turns acting out romantic phrases, song titles, or holiday game is particularly effective at breaking the ice and getting people to step out of their comfort it requires no special equipment other than a few slips of paper, it is an easy addition to any party resulting laughter and friendly competition make it a truly memorable experience for everyone involved.

8. Cupid Arrow Shoot

Cupid Arrow Shoot - 25 Valentine's Day Party Game Ideas

Bring a bit of mythology to your party with a fun and safe Cupid Arrow toy bows and foam-tipped arrows, guests can aim for heart-shaped targets pinned to a wall or a hay game provides a great photo opportunity and allows participants to test their precision and can increase the difficulty by placing targets at different heights or is an especially popular choice for kids 'parties, but adults often find themselves getting competitive as they try to hit the activity adds a unique, active element to your Valentine' s Day event that guests will surely appreciate.

9. Valentine Word Scramble

Valentine Word Scramble - 25 Valentine's Day Party Game Ideas

For those who enjoy a bit of a mental challenge, a Valentine Word Scramble is a quiet yet engaging each guest with a sheet containing jumbled letters that form words related to the holiday, such as "affection, " "sweetheart, " or "celebration. " You can set a timer to see who can unscramble the most words the fastest, or let guests work on them at their own pace during game is easy to print at home and can be customized with words that are specific to your group of is a versatile option that fits perfectly into any part of your party schedule.

10. Heart Balloon Pop

Heart Balloon Pop - 25 Valentine's Day Party Game Ideas

Add a burst of excitement to your celebration with a high-energy Heart Balloon Pop several red and pink balloons with small treats, confetti, or slips of paper containing "dares" or "prizes. " Guests must then try to pop the balloons using only their bodies β€” no hands allowed! This often leads to hilarious situations as people try to sit or stomp on the balloons to reveal the hidden contents is a visually vibrant game that creates a festive atmosphere and keeps everyone on their anticipation of what is inside each balloon adds an extra layer of fun to the entire experience.

11. Valentine Memory Game

Valentine Memory Game - 25 Valentine's Day Party Game Ideas

Test your guests' focus and observation skills with a classic Valentine Memory out a series of cards face down, each featuring a romantic image or holiday symbol such as a diamond ring, a lovebird, or a take turns flipping over two cards at a time, trying to find a matching game is excellent for younger children but can be made more challenging for adults by using a larger number of cards or more intricate is a calm and focused activity that provides a nice change of pace from more energetic games, allowing for meaningful interaction and shared concentration.

12. Musical Hearts

Musical Hearts - 25 Valentine's Day Party Game Ideas

Put a romantic spin on the traditional musical chairs by playing Musical of chairs, place large paper hearts on the floor in a circle, ensuring there is one fewer heart than there are the music plays, participants walk around the circle, and when the music stops, they must quickly find a heart to stand person left without a heart is out, and one heart is removed for the next upbeat love songs makes the game feel festive and is a wonderful way to get everyone moving and laughing, making it a hit for school or home parties.

13. Valentine Minute To Win It

Valentine Minute To Win It - 25 Valentine's Day Party Game Ideas

If you want to keep the energy levels high, a series of Valentine Minute To Win It games is the way to short, sixty-second challenges can include tasks like moving candies from one bowl to another using only a straw or balancing a stack of conversation hearts on a tongue depressor held in the games are designed to be silly and fast-paced, ensuring that no one gets are perfect for large groups where you can have multiple stations running at quick nature of the tasks keeps the momentum going and provides endless entertainment for both participants and spectators.

14. Love Letter Mad Libs

Love Letter Mad Libs - 25 Valentine's Day Party Game Ideas

Bring some humor to your gathering with Love Letter Mad Libs, a game that often results in ridiculous and heartwarming guests with a template of a romantic letter with key words missing, such as adjectives, nouns, and seeing the context, guests provide their own words to fill in the blanks, and then the completed letters are read aloud to the nonsensical combinations usually lead to fits of laughter and provide a lighthearted way to celebrate the theme of is a great activity for a sit-down dinner or a relaxed evening where storytelling and humor are the main focus.

15. Valentine Bean Bag Toss

Valentine Bean Bag Toss - 25 Valentine's Day Party Game Ideas

A Valentine Bean Bag Toss is a classic game that is easy to set up and fun for a target board with heart-shaped cutouts of varying sizes, assigning different point values to each take turns throwing small bean bags, perhaps in shades of red and pink, trying to score as many points as game is durable and can be used year after year, making it a great investment for holiday encourages friendly competition and helps develop hand-eye coordination, making it a perfect addition to a family-oriented Valentine's Day party or a community event in a local park.

16. Guess The Number Of Candy Hearts

Guess The Number Of Candy Hearts - 25 Valentine's Day Party Game Ideas

One of the simplest yet most engaging activities is the Guess The Number Of Candy Hearts a large, clear glass jar with hundreds of colorful conversation hearts and place it in a prominent small slips of paper and a pen for guests to write down their best estimate of how many candies are the end of the party, the person whose guess is closest to the actual number wins the entire jar of candy or a special game is excellent because it requires no active supervision and serves as a continuous point of conversation throughout the entire event.

17. Valentine Emoji Pictionary

Valentine Emoji Pictionary - 25 Valentine's Day Party Game Ideas

Modernize your party games with Valentine Emoji Pictionary, a fun twist that uses digital symbols to represent romantic phrases or movie are given a list of emoji combinations and must decode them to find the hidden example, a heart and a ring might represent "proposal. " This game is very popular with younger generations and can be easily printed or shared on a challenges guests to think creatively and interpret visual clues in a new is a quick and effective icebreaker that gets people talking and laughing as they compare their interpretations of the various emoji puzzles.

18. Heart To Heart Conversation Starters

Heart To Heart Conversation Starters - 25 Valentine's Day Party Game Ideas

Encourage deeper connections among your guests with Heart To Heart Conversation a bowl filled with thought-provoking questions on each table, such as "What is your favorite romantic memory? " or "What does love mean to you? " These prompts help guests move beyond small talk and engage in more meaningful activity is particularly well-suited for a dinner party or a quiet Galentine's gathering where the goal is to strengthen friendships and share personal creates a warm and intimate atmosphere, allowing everyone to feel more connected and appreciated throughout the evening, making the celebration feel truly special and personal for every guest.

19. Valentine Photo Booth Props

Valentine Photo Booth Props - 25 Valentine's Day Party Game Ideas

While not a game in the traditional sense, using Valentine Photo Booth Props can be turned into a fun "best pose" a variety of themed items like oversized glasses, cardboard lips, heart-shaped wands, and romantic can take turns posing for photos, and you can later award prizes for the "most creative" or "silliest" activity provides guests with a lasting memento of the party and encourages them to be playful and acts as a great social hub where people can interact and create memories together, ensuring that the festive spirit is captured in every single snapshot taken during the event.

20. Heart Relay Race

Heart Relay Race - 25 Valentine's Day Party Game Ideas

Get everyone active with a Heart Relay Race that combines physical movement with holiday guests into teams and have them carry a paper heart on a spoon or balance it on their heads while racing to a finish line and make it more challenging, you can add obstacles or require participants to perform a specific task, like blowing a kiss, before handing off the heart to the next game is perfect for outdoor settings or large halls and is guaranteed to generate lots of cheers and promotes teamwork and provides a healthy dose of exercise amidst all the holiday treats.

21. Valentine Candy Tasting

Valentine Candy Tasting - 25 Valentine's Day Party Game Ideas

Indulge your guests' sweet teeth with a Valentine Candy Tasting participants and have them sample various holiday-themed treats, such as different flavors of chocolate truffles, gummy hearts, or specialty must then try to identify the flavor or the specific type of candy they are can provide scorecards for them to record their guesses and rate their sensory experience is both delicious and entertaining, making it a hit for foodies and candy lovers adds a sophisticated yet fun element to the party, allowing guests to appreciate the diverse flavors of the season in an interactive way.

22. Pin The Heart On The Cupid

Pin The Heart On The Cupid - 25 Valentine's Day Party Game Ideas

A romantic variation of the classic "Pin the Tail on the Donkey, " Pin The Heart On The Cupid is a nostalgic game that never goes out of a guest, spin them around a few times, and then have them try to place a paper heart as close as possible to the target on a large poster of results are often hilarious as hearts end up in the most unexpected game is simple to prepare and provides plenty of entertainment for both the player and the is a charming addition to any Valentine's Day party, especially those with a vintage or traditional theme.

23. Valentine Origami Craft

Valentine Origami Craft - 25 Valentine's Day Party Game Ideas

For a more creative and relaxing activity, set up a Valentine Origami Craft guests with red, pink, and white paper along with instructions on how to fold them into beautiful heart shapes, flowers, or even little activity allows guests to take a break from the more high-energy games and create something beautiful that they can take home as a party is a wonderful way to encourage mindfulness and artistic expression during the can even turn it into a friendly competition by seeing who can create the most intricate or smallest origami heart within a set time limit.

24. Heart Shaped Puzzle Race

Heart Shaped Puzzle Race - 25 Valentine's Day Party Game Ideas

Challenge your guests 'problem-solving skills with a Heart Shaped Puzzle or create several heart-shaped jigsaw puzzles with varying levels of guests into small teams and see which group can complete their puzzle the game requires communication and collaboration, making it a great team-building add an extra layer of fun, you can use puzzles that feature a custom photo of the host group or a romantic sense of accomplishment when the final piece is placed makes this a rewarding and engaging game for any Valentine' s Day gathering, providing a satisfying conclusion to the competitive festivities.

25. Valentine Escape Room

Valentine Escape Room - 25 Valentine's Day Party Game Ideas

Transform a room in your home into a Valentine Escape Room for the ultimate immersive a series of puzzles and riddles related to the holiday that guests must solve to "unlock" the door or find a hidden theme could be "Rescuing Cupid 's Arrows" or "Finding the Secret Love Potion. " This activity requires careful planning and preparation but offers a highly engaging and memorable experience for your encourages critical thinking and intense cooperation, making it a standout feature of any thrill of solving the final puzzle before time runs out provides a fantastic climax to your Valentine' s Day celebration.
